Laser gum surgery utilizes focused light beams to treat various gum conditions with precision and minimal invasiveness. Unlike traditional scalpel methods, lasers reduce bleeding, discomfort, and recovery time. This advanced technique effectively removes diseased tissue, sterilizes the area, and can reshape gums, promoting faster healing and preserving more healthy tissue around your teeth.
LANAP (Laser Assisted New Attachment Procedure): A specific protocol using a Nd:YAG laser to treat periodontitis by removing infected tissue and stimulating bone regeneration.
LAPT (Laser Assisted Periodontal Therapy): A broader term for various laser applications in periodontal care, including debridement and disinfection.
Laser Gingivectomy: Reshaping or removal of excess gum tissue, often for cosmetic purposes or to treat gingival enlargement.
Laser Frenectomy: A procedure to modify the frenum (a small band of tissue), improving speech or preventing gum recession.
Laser Debridement and Sterilization: Using lasers to remove plaque, calculus, and bacteria from root surfaces, along with sterilizing infected pockets.
The specific steps for laser gum surgery depend on your condition and the chosen treatment plan.
Local anesthesia is applied to numb the treatment area, ensuring comfort throughout the procedure. The dental team will ensure you are relaxed and ready.
A specialized dental laser carefully targets and removes diseased gum tissue and bacteria from periodontal pockets. The laser seals blood vessels and nerve endings as it works, minimizing bleeding and post-operative discomfort.
After diseased tissue removal, the root surfaces are thoroughly cleaned. In some cases, the laser is used to stimulate regeneration of bone and gum tissue, completing the procedure with precision and care.
Recovery from laser gum surgery is generally quicker and less painful than traditional methods. Patients typically experience mild discomfort, swelling, or sensitivity for a few days. Detailed post-operative instructions will cover soft food diets, gentle oral hygiene, and medication management. Follow-up appointments are crucial to monitor healing and ensure optimal results. Most patients can resume normal activities within a day or two.
Laser gum surgery boasts high success rates for improving gum health, reducing pocket depths, and promoting tissue regeneration. Outcomes depend on the initial condition, the type of procedure, and diligent post-operative care by the patient. Maintaining excellent oral hygiene and attending regular dental check-ups are key to long-term success and stable gum health.
The cost of laser gum surgery in Hyderabad varies based on several factors, including the complexity of the gum condition, the number of teeth requiring treatment, the specific laser technology used, the dental clinic's reputation, and the specialist's experience. Package deals often include consultations, the procedure itself, and follow-up care.
Generally, laser gum surgery in Hyderabad can range from approximately INR 15,000 to INR 60,000 per quadrant or per procedure, depending on the extent of work needed.
